Territory of Florida }
County of St.. John } Before me S. Streeter Justice of the Peace, in and for said County
on this 19th day of May AD 1829 personally appeared Maria l. Fatio wife of Francis
I. Fatio, within mentioned, who being privately examined by me separate and apart from
her said Husband, did acknowledge and declare that the above relinquishment and
renunciation of Dower by her, was made freely and voluntarily, and without any com
pulsion, constraint, apprehension, or fear from her said Husband.
S. Streeter J. Of the Peace
